The foodtech will use yeast as hosts to initially produce casein and whey protein, two of the main proteins found in milk.
Bioreacted casein would be a HUGE leap for cow-free dairy. I remember when Perfect Day started up they were having too much trouble producing casein, so their products couldn't be used to make stringy or melty cheese.
